Sesquiterpene Lactones from the Roots of Ixeris sonchifolia

  • Three known sesquiterpene lactones were isolated from the n-BuOH traction of the roots of Ixeris sonchifolia. Their structures were identified as macrocliniside A (1), glucozaluzanin C (2), and ixerin H (3), by spectral analyses. Compounds 1 and 2 are guaiane-type, while compound 3 is a germacrane-type sesquiterpene lactone. Compounds 1-3 are first isolated from I. sonchifolia.

Cytotoxic Terpenes and Lignans from the Roots of Ainsliaea acerifolia

  • The chromatographic separation of the MeOH extract of the roots of Ainsliaea acerifolia (Compositae) led to the isolation of six known terpenes and two known lignans. Their structures were identified by spectroscopic methods as mokko lactone (1), betulonic acid (2), betulinic acid (3), zaluzanin C (4), $1{\beta}-hydroperoxygermacra-4(15)$, 5, 10(14)-triene (5), pluviatilol (6), (+)-syringaresinol (7), and glucozaluzanin C (8). Compounds $1{\sim}4$ and 8 showed non-specific significant cytotoxicity against five human tumor cell lines with $ED_{50}$ values ranging from $0.36{\sim}5.54{\mu}g/mL$.

Phytochemical Constituents of Ainsliaea acerifolia (단풍취의 식물화학적 성분)

  • Three sesquiterpene lactones (1, 2 and 5) and two lipid glycerols (3 and 4) were isolated from MeOH extract of Ainsliaea acerifolia (Compositae). Based on spectral data, their chemical structures were determined as estafiatone (1), zaluzanin C (2), 3-O-(9Z, 12Z, 15Z-octadecatrienoyl) glycerol (3), 3-O-(9Z, 12Z-octadecadienoyl) glycerol (4) and glucozaluzanin C (5). Compounds 1, 3 and 4 were previously not reported from Ainsliaea species.

Cytotoxic and ACAT-inhibitory Sesquiterpene Lactones from the Root of Ixeris dentata forma albiflora

  • Ixeris dentata forma albiflora was extracted with 80% aqueous MeOH, and the concentrated extract was partitioned with EtOAc, n-BuOH and $H_{2}O$. Eight sesquiterpenes were isolated through repeated silica gel and octadecyl silica gel ($C_{18},\;ODS$) column chromatography of the EtOAc and n-BuOH fractions. Physicochemical analysis using NMR, MS and IR revealed the chemical structures of the sesquiterpenes, which were zaluzanin (1), 9a-hydroxyguaian-4(15), 10(14), 11 (13)-triene-6, 12-olide(2), $3{\beta}-O-{\beta}-D-glucopyranosyl-8{\beta}-hydroxyguaian$-4(15), 10(14)-diene-6, 12-olide (3), $3-O-{\beta}-D-glucopyranosyl-8{\beta}-hydroxyguauan$-10(14)-ene-6, 12-olide (4), ixerin M (5), glucozaluzanin C (6), crepiside I (7), and ixerin D (8). This is the first time that these sesquiterpene lactones have been isolated from this plant. Compounds 1, 2 and 7 revealed relatively high cytotoxicities on human colon carcinoma cell and lung adeno-carcinoma cell, while compounds 5 and 7 showed acyl-CoA: cholesterol acyltransferase (ACAT) inhibitory activity.
